N2 - Learning analytics consists of gathering and analyzing data from students in order to understand complex aspects of the learning process and promote its improvement. Currently, there is a lack of tools that allow the visualization of multimodal data. In this paper, we present a visualizer that allows analyzing the data provided by a multimodal learning analytics software. The multimodal data visualizer, in addition to allowing to visualize 10 body postures, permits applying clustering techniques, such as k-means. As validation, we analyze the data provided of 43 engineering student presentations.
